Court Stays $8B Trump Tariff Ruling, DOJ Appeals

Story summary
  • Federal Circuit Court of Appeals stayed the ruling on Trump administration’s 10% Section 122 tariff for three importers, while U.S. collected $8 billion in March and 170,000 importers paid deposits for 13 million entries since February.
  • Justice Department appealed on May 11 and may seek Court stay, with Trade Representative Jamieson Greer and Commerce Secretary Howard Lutnick arguing tariff expires in July unless extended and is vital for negotiations and to curb import spikes.
